January 13, 201115 yr Member From SID: Soaps In Depth has learned that Réal Andrews (ex-Taggert, GENERAL HOSPITAL; Walker, AS THE WORLD TURNS) is returning to daytime! The actor -- who most recently played Keith on the Web soap THE BAY -- is headed to ALL MY CHILDREN as Agent Trumble! Although Andrews is currently scheduled to appear in 7 episodes, word is that the role could become a recurring one.
